Output 40b4248f9ce213612fbab809ff61e82d8d9a7fe9da35a8a980ce18888266dc6c:1

value
270794446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f828aedfce48a30c6c7cca14fc0cdfffb72129fb OP_EQUAL
address
3QKAEq3jZQw9rFst7unno6yYfuxzFgtAbq
transaction
40b4248f9ce213612fbab809ff61e82d8d9a7fe9da35a8a980ce18888266dc6c